[quote=Anonymous] I live in West Springfield (not Orange Hunt though). I see lots of things besides Crape Myrtles, Magnolias, etc. !! In fact, we have maples, oaks, sweet gums, ash, pines of various types, fruit trees (cherries, crabapple, pear), etc. just on my block. My husband and I have lilacs, willow bushes, Japanese maple, gardenias, camelias, leatherleaf mahonias, azaleas, hollies, dogwood, dahlias, butterfly bush, and others that I don't have the names for on the tip of my tongue. And I do love the Susans and coneflowers also. [/quote]
